THE PERFECT EYE. “Despite a lack of molecular details available at the time, he offered a rational hypothesis to explain this seemingly impossible puzzle, ‘If numerous gradations from a perfect and complex eye to one very imperfect and simple, each grade being useful to its possessor, can be shown to exist…then the difficulty of believing that a perfect and complex eye could be formed by natural selection, though insuperable by our imagination, can hardly be considered real.” (Darwin, 1859).
